Karim Benzema sets La Liga title target ahead of El Clasico

Real Madrid striker Karim Benzema has thrown down a La Liga title challenge ahead of their crunch El Clasico.

Zinedine Zidane's head to the Camp Nou level on points with league leaders Barcelona, after Benzema netted a 96th minute equaliser away at Valencia.

The former French international is in excellent form ahead of the trip to Catalonia, and he is confident of a positive result against their old enemy on December 18.

"I am playing with confidence at the moment, and that has helped me to score more goals," he told reporters from Marca in his post-match interview.

"I want to win La Liga this season, that is my target."

"I will help the team in any way I can, with goals and leadership in the coming games."

"It will be difficult to play away at the Camp Nou, but hopefully we can win."

"It is always the most important game of the season."

The 31-year old has 16 goals in 21 games in all competitions so far this season, however he will be looking to improve his record against Barcelona, with no goal in his last 10 appearances against them.
